Wm. C. Sanders/(Saunders as family always claimed) married Louisa Hills about
1830 in Onondaga County, Ny. Louisa Hills is the dau., of Joel Hills and
Mary "Polly" Fox. Louisa is descendant of Wm Hills one of the cofounders of
Hartford, Connecticut. Our branch is via Elisha Hills and Rebecca Loveland.
But to move on, many of my Sanders were born in Ny in and or around the
Onondaga County area. They eventually migrated to Michigan for a few years
and helped in the building of railroads there. Then they moved on to Green
County, Albany Wisconsin area. Joel and Mary "Polly" and others are buried
Gap Cemetery just out side of Albany Wisconsin. But this is where my Ggfa
Joel Cornealius Sanders married Ruehwama (Rewama) Cessna dau., of Oliver
Cessna & Martha Ann Baughman. Oliver and some of the Hills are mentioned in
the History of Green County. Oliver & Martha's and Hills and my Ggfa & wife
moved on to Iowa. I about forgot there was a J. Baughman in Green Co., also
and many of the Baughman's were also in Iowa. My gmo Riddle was Mary Sanders
and she was born Hardin Co., Iowa. My GGgmo Louisa Hills is buried in
Waterloo, Blackhawk County, Iowa.
